In light of a recent Harvard study on California’s low graduation rate for students of color, Forum examines the causes of and solutions to the drop-out problem.

Guests:

Daniel J. Losen, senior education law and policy associate at the Harvard Civil Rights Project

Rick Miller, director of communications for the State Superintendent of Public Instruction Jack O'Connell

Nate Jones, intervention specialist at Lakeview Elementary in Oakland where he works with children on math, Outward Bound tutor at Oakland High School, tutors at risk students at the Berkeley Library

Esperanza Zendejas, superintendent at East Side Union High School District
